T-Mobile USA is a national provider of wireless voice, messaging, and data services capable of reaching over 293 million Americans where they live, work, and play. T-Mobile needed an enterprise-wide solution that aggregated logs for PCI compliance, monitoring, troubleshooting, performance management and identifying security risks–they'll tell you why Splunk was the answer.

 

HealthTrans is the 4th largest PBM (Prescription Benefits Manager) by claim volume in the county. HealthTrans processes 100 million claims annually and represents over 15 million patients. Splunk is critical in helping HealthTrans prove compliance across large swaths of data to protect personal health information (HIPAA compliance), facilitate security investigations, learn of increases of erred transactions in real-time, and monitor file changes for SLA compliance.

 

Cricket is the pioneer of simple and affordable, prepaid, unlimited wireless services, serving more than 5.3 million customers in 35 states and the District of Columbia. Cricket is using Splunk to derive operational intelligence from web and application data.
